What area is SoHo New York?

Located west of Little Italy and bounded by Houston Street, West Broadway and Lafayette Street, SoHo (acronym for South Houston) is one of the most popular neighborhoods of New York City. The nearby neighborhoods are Little Italy to the east, TriBeCa to the south and West Village to the north.

What is SoHo known for NYC?

SoHo is short for “south of Houston Street.” Today, the neighborhood is famous for its upscale boutiques, artists, and cast-iron architecture. But in the mid-1900s, SoHo was known for its factories and industries, earning it the nickname “Hell’s Hundred Acres.”

Is Soho in New York or London?

Soho is an area of the City of Westminster, part of the West End of London. Originally a fashionable district for the aristocracy, it has been one of the main entertainment districts in the capital since the 19th century.

Is TriBeCa part of SoHo?

Demographics. For census purposes, the New York City government classifies Tribeca as part of a larger neighborhood tabulation area called SoHo-TriBeCa-Civic Center-Little Italy.
